Computer connection lost.

My internet connection stops responding, and I can't access messenger programs or webpages.

I'll be surfing the net then all of a sudden, my connection stops responding and I must restart my PC (I've tried simply turning off/on the router and modem, it doesn't work). When my PC reboots, everything's fine for a while, then it happens again.

I've got the latest versions of Mcafee and Zonealarm

But, obviously something is wrong.
